VENDOR SPACES:
Provided Vendor Spaces are based on 10' x 10' tent size or standard mobil unit.
Additional Space and Amenities may be purchased a la carte (below). 
No electricity will be provided.
Payment for Vendor Space may be paid to Philadelphia VegFest. We will provide an invoice upon approval.

VENDORS/EXHIBITORS PRODUCT GUIDELINES:
All food and products must be 100% vegan. No animal products nor animal byproducts (shells, feathers, bones, honey, hair, fur, leather, etc.)

Food Vendors are responsible for required approval and licenses with the City of Philadelphia Department of Public Health (Food Services) and the Office of Licensing and Inspection (L&I). We can help if you need help.
1. Temporary or Permanent Event Food Service Application with Dept. of Public Health (SELLERS AND SAMPLERS)
2. Temporary or Permanent Special Event Vendor License (#3112) from Office of L&I (ALL FOOD SELLERS)
